Winning With Risk Management written by Russell Walker and has been published by World Scientific this book supported file pdf, txt, epub, kindle and other format this book has been release on 2013 with Business & Economics categories.


This book develops the notion that companies can succeed on the basis of risk management, much as companies compete on efficiency, costs, labor, location, and other dimensions. The reality of risk and how it impacts companies is that it is much more definite, often catastrophic and looks more like a shock. This is striking, as a difference between firms on risk different than a marginal difference in operating efficiencies, for example. Competing on Risk Management requires a discipline, a commitment to using information and recognizing shocks and then acting upon those to redistribute assets. This book will examine how leading firms that compete on risk have done this and showcase best practices and impacts to the capital structure of firms and their organizational formation.

If you think risk management is a bit of meaningless management-speak, this is the book for you. The world is full of risks and they all need managing. In fact, we all manage risks all the time whether well or badly. Every decision we make involves making some assessment of the risks involved. Risk management is simply an attempt at doing it more explicitly, scientifically and, hopefully, effectively. In this book, readers will learn more about the whys and hows of risk management, and examples of how not to do it. I have tried to explain it in everyday language and show how it can be applied in a small business to your advantage.

Learn the art--and science--of risk management In this exceptionally lucid, accessible book, one of the most highly regarded industry experts illuminates the delicate process of making decisions in an uncertain world and helps both lay people and professional risk managers understand the role of "risk-management" in their work, their lives, and their businesses. This book will enable professional risk managers to truly grasp the concepts behind their tools, and it will enable their clients (investors) and their coworkers to understand them as well. Handy and easy-to-read, The Book of Risk provides a down-to-earth look at an exciting field that has practical applications for everyone. Dan Borge, PhD (Clinton Corners, NY), was managing director and partner at Bankers Trust Company. He was with Bankers Trust for the last twenty years and was the architect of the first-ever risk management system implemented institutionally--Bankers Trust's renowned RAROC system. Prior to working at Bankers Trust, he designed airplanes at Boeing. He is an aeronautical engineer and has a PhD in finance from Harvard Business School.
